Manchester United 3-0 Nottingham Forest: The 1865 Premier League Match Report

It was a comfortable victory for the home team as Forest huffed and puffed, but provided very little threat to the Manchester United goal. First half efforts in quick succession from Marcus Rashford and Antony Martial effectively killed the game, although things could have been different if one of Ryan Yates' efforts had crept in; the first was saved, and the second snuck in off the leg of Willy Boly, who was in an offside position. Nottingham Forest 2-3 AFC Bournemouth: The 1865 Premier League Match Report

This one felt far worse than being hit for six by Man City, as the Reds lost the battles on and off the pitch against one of our rivals (at least in terms of possible league positions). With Scott Parker gone, Gary O'Neil showed tactical awareness by changing formations and approach in the second half, and Steve Cooper and his team were simply unable to respond. It had all felt so good at half-time as well, with Brennan Johnson's spot kick adding to Cheikhou Kouyate's header (from a corner!), but Phil Billing's 30 yard rocket swung the momentum back towards the visitors early in the second half, as the Reds lost the physical and tactical battles. Manchester City 6-0 Nottingham Forest: The 1865 Premier League Match Report

It was a humbling night for Steve Cooper's Reds at the Etihad, where they were soundly beaten by the world's best coach, best striker, and then they brought the best midfielder off the bench. The key thing here is that City were just too good, but Forest's gaffer admitted afterwards that the away side were naive and there was much to learn. Nottingham Forest 0-2 Tottenham Hotspur: The 1865 Premier League Match Report

It was a disappointing defeat but positive performance from Steve Cooper's men, as the opposition showed what a difference a striker can make. Forest had chances, most notably from Ryan Yates and Neco Williams, but apart from Lewis O'Brien's long-range effort, Hugo Lloris did not have a save to make. On the other hand, Harry Kane had three chances, and although his penalty was well-saved, he was clinical in scoring a brace. Grimsby Town 0-3 Nottingham Forest: The 1865 Carabao Cup Match Report

The Reds made the trip to Blundell Park, ate their chippy tea and made eleven changes to the starting line up as Steve Cooper took the opportunity to get minutes into the legs of some players. Ryan Yates, Remo Freuler and Guilian Biancone put themselves back in the mix; Emmanuel Dennis, Sam Surridge and Loic Mbe Soh will have appreciated the minutes; and for youngsters such as Aaron Donnelly and Zach Abbott, it will have been a dream come true (Abbott gets his GCSE results this week!). Guest reporter George Edwards shares his thoughts on the game, fresh from his evening out at the seaside, as impressive first half finishes from Yates and Surridge gave control to the Reds, before Grimsby came back at us and we needed Surridge's second goal of the night to put the game to bed.
